Date :Définition
A reaction between an acid and a base as a result of which the distinguishing properties of the acid and base disappear, the products of the reaction being a salt and water, for example: 2KOH + H2SO4 = K2SO4 + 2H2O.
The process of adding an acid or alkali to a solution to make that solution neutral or inert.Note :
This common acid-base reaction is used in laboratory analysis (titration).
